Balboa v. Comcast Corporation

RICO / Consumer / Other Statutes Terminated 01/20/2017 District Court, M.D. Tennessee

Balboa v. Comcast Corporation is a federal rico / consumer / other statutes lawsuit filed on 05/27/2016 in the District Court, M.D. Tennessee. The case was terminated on 01/20/2017.

A lawsuit records allegations and procedural activity. Being named as a party does not establish liability, wrongdoing, or the merits of any claim.
